Oromia president to focus on reviewing results and fixing gaps

Oromia Regional President Ato Shumelis Abdissa said the administration will focus on reviewing achieved results and addressing gaps across various sectors. This comes after the third quarter performance evaluation of government and party activities for 2018 Ethiopian calendar year.

Addis Ababa, Miyazya 9, 2018 (Fana) – Oromia Regional President Ato Shumelis Abdissa stated in a social media post that noticeable results have been achieved across all sectors in recent weeks.

The regional administration has agreed to prioritize reviewing these successes and remedying identified shortcomings, he said.

In the coming weeks, efforts will focus on successfully preparing for the 7th general election, according to Shumelis.

Additionally, planning for the 2019 budget year will account for the prevailing national situation, he added.
